About Daniel

- What kind of experience do you have?

Regarding teaching I have been a private teacher since 2012 and have recently started working as a cover teacher in schools.
I gained important experience teaching and coaching early and modern music on a number of summer courses in Spain, France and Luxembourg.
As a specialist period instrument performer I participated as a tutor on workshops and outreach projects for then Orchestra of the Age of Enlightenment and Shakespeare's Globe.

- Tell me about your qualifications.

I received my MMus from the Royal College of Music and a BMus from the Royal Northern College of Music. I currently undertake further part-time studies at the Schola Cantorum Basiliensis, (CH) in preparation to my planned Ph.D project.
